How to File an Accident Claim

You should provide as much detail about the accident as possible to your insurer and agent. This will allow you to receive the compensation you are entitled to.

When your insurance company evaluates the damage to your vehicle, they can decide to either repair it or to reimburse you for actual cash value (ACV) in the event that it is not economically feasible to fix it.

1. Call the police

You should always report car accidents unless you have a automobile policy that eliminates the need for you to call the police. Even if the accident only causes minor damage the police will draft an official accident report which can be helpful when filing an insurance claim or pursuing lawsuits against the responsible party.

The police will conduct an exhaustive investigation, talking to all the parties involved and witnesses. They will also determine who is at fault. A police officer's opinion about what happened and who was to blame in addition to evidence found at the crash scene, can be extremely useful in seeking compensation from an insurance company or a court.

It is possible to make a claim through your insurance company without any police report, this may make it more difficult to prove negligence and receive a fair settlement. It is essential to contact the police if involved in an accident resulting in injuries. This not only satisfies your legal duties however, it also helps to set yourself up for success in you seek to file a claim against the other driver.

If the other driver is unwilling to let you verify their information, this is a red flag that something is not right. Contact the police to make sure everyone is honest and to prevent tempers from becoming out of control in a stressful moment.

2. Gather Information

As soon as you're in a position to do so, and it is safe and practical, start gathering information about the accident. This could include photos of the damage to your car as well as license plate numbers, the timing of the day and weather conditions as well as road angles. It is also beneficial to know the names and contact details for any witnesses. Finally, be careful when you speak - the statements made at the scene of the crash could come back to haunt you later.

The insurance company needs to determine who is at fault for the accident. This is usually determined by looking over the state laws that define the fault and analyzing the evidence. The report will be based on the statements of all parties involved, including the police and witnesses.

This is why it's vital to keep medical records and bills as and any medical reports that are related to the accident. The insurance company may wish to have the medical records as well as doctor's notes analyzed by an independent medical examiner (IME).

It is crucial to have a repair estimate when your vehicle has been damaged in an accident. These estimates will help the insurance company determine the value of your vehicle in cash which they will use to determine how much they will reimburse you.

Generally speaking, damages are divided into two categories: general and special. Special damages are ones that can be quantifiably measured, such as medical bills and lost wage. General damages, like pain and suffering are more difficult to quantify. Documentation of the amount of both damages will be necessary for a successful claim. 3. Contact Your Insurance Company

Most insurance companies will ask for documentation regarding the incident. This could include medical records and receipts for the expenses related to your injury as also evidence of the loss of income due to time spent working. The insurer will also review your vehicle, as well as the damage caused by an accident. The insurer will then use these details to determine the worth of your claim and issue a check to pay compensation.

It is important to state the facts regarding what happened when you contact your insurance company. It is also important to avoid engaging in a heated discussion with the representative as this can make things worse. It is also important to be clear about any injuries that you've suffered and only disclose the details after your doctor confirms that it is true.
